Samsung’s new Wi-Fi tech transfers 1GB movie in 3 seconds

October 13, 2014 By Kunal Gangar Leave a Comment

Samsung has developed a new Wi-Fi technology that enables really fast transmission speed compared to the existing Wi-Fi technologies. Samsung has developed a 60GHz Wi-Fi technology that increases the current transmission speed of 108MB per second to 575MB per second. Wi-Fi and WiGig Alliance team up to expand Wi-Fi technology

May 10, 2010 By Kunal Gangar Leave a Comment

  Wireless Gigabit Alliance (WiGig) and Wi-Fi Alliance have agreed to cooperate on the development of the next-generation Wi-Fi certification program. In this program, both the associations will align their technology specifications so that Wi-Fi can be operated without any issues in the 60GHz frequency band. Cisco launches WAP610N Dual-band Router in India

April 23, 2010 By Kunal Gangar Leave a Comment

  Cisco has launched a new dual-band router for the Indian market. It’s the Linksys WAP610N that works on both 2.4GHz and 5GHz frequencies and allows you to change the frequency if there’s too much crowding or interference. WiGig Alliance promises 10x faster wireless than Wi-Fi

December 10, 2009 By Kinjal Sangoi Leave a Comment

  Wireless Gigabit Alliance aka WiGig have completed their unified wireless specification that will enable high-speed data transfers, even faster than Wi-Fi.
